> The HD in the 2nd-try server is a 80GB Maxtor.
> I tried again with a 40GB Maxtor - still no luck.
> I then went and removed all IDE-HDs from the 1st-try server
> (2*IDE,2*SCSI) and installed it on the 1st SCSI-disk, which is some 9GB
> Quantum Atlas.
> That worked.
> So, pfSense (or rather, the installer: I can install and boot 6B5 in any
> case) seems to have problems with "big" disks - is this normal?
> To relate to that, I've got three (exactly identical)
> FreeBSD5.4-servers, each with 2*120 GB Samsung disks on a twe and all of
> those can't boot from the disk directly - in their case, I use a SuSE9.2
> install-CD that boots the OS from the HD after a timeout.
